The Poland Automotive Power Electronics Market is witnessing significant growth driven by the rising demand for electric vehicles (EVs) and the increasing adoption of advanced driver-assistance systems (ADAS) in vehicles. The market is characterized by the presence of key players such as Infineon Technologies, STMicroelectronics, and Texas Instruments, who are focusing on developing innovative power electronics solutions to cater to the evolving automotive industry. Additionally, government initiatives promoting sustainable transportation and stringent emission regulations are further fueling the market growth. The automotive power electronics market in Poland is expected to continue expanding as automakers increasingly incorporate electrification and connectivity features in their vehicles, leading to a surge in demand for power electronics components such as inverters, converters, and power modules.

In the Poland Automotive Power Electronics Market, several challenges are faced by industry players. One major challenge is the rapid technological advancements in electric vehicles (EVs) and autonomous driving systems, which require complex power electronic components. This demands continuous research and development efforts to stay competitive and meet evolving industry standards. Additionally, the market is highly competitive, with both domestic and international players vying for market share. Ensuring compliance with stringent regulations and standards regarding safety, efficiency, and emissions further adds to the complexity for companies operating in this sector. Moreover, fluctuating raw material prices and supply chain disruptions can impact production costs and lead times, posing additional challenges for market participants in Poland`s automotive power electronics industry.

Government policies related to the Poland Automotive Power Electronics Market focus on promoting the adoption of electric vehicles (EVs) and reducing greenhouse gas emissions. The Polish government offers incentives such as subsidies and tax breaks to consumers purchasing EVs, as well as funding for the development of charging infrastructure. Additionally, there are regulations in place to enforce emission standards and promote the use of renewable energy sources in the automotive industry. The government aims to accelerate the transition towards cleaner and more sustainable transportation options, driving the demand for automotive power electronics in the market. Overall, these policies create a favorable environment for the growth of the automotive power electronics sector in Poland.
